    Yep, Reck is right. Ubi is one of those companies where if you are playing their games you have to make a uplay account. i mainly play on PC, so tbh i just buy from ubi directly and play them in uplay most of the time, but even if you buy a ubi game on Steam it will still force you to play it in uplay.
